Maison > Problème commun > le corps du texte

Comment créer un sujet dans Kafka

百草
Libérer: 2024-01-17 16:56:22
original
2042 Les gens l'ont consulté

Étapes pour Kafka pour créer un sujet : 1. Installez et configurez Kafka ; 2. Créez un sujet ; 3. Vérifiez la création du sujet ; 5. Pensez à utiliser Kafka Manager ou Confluent Control Center ; Introduction détaillée : 1. Installez et configurez Kafka. Tout d'abord, assurez-vous que Kafka a été correctement installé et qu'il fonctionne. Selon les besoins et l'environnement, configurez les paramètres de Kafka, etc.

Comment créer un sujet dans Kafka

Le système d'exploitation de ce tutoriel : système Windows 10, ordinateur DELL G3.

Apache Kafka est une plate-forme de traitement de flux distribuée permettant de créer des pipelines de données en temps réel et des applications de streaming. Dans Kafka, un sujet est une classification ou une classification de messages. Les producteurs envoient des messages à des sujets spécifiques, et les consommateurs s'abonnent et consomment ces messages. Pour créer un sujet Kafka, vous devez suivre les étapes suivantes :

1. Installer et configurer Kafka : Tout d'abord, assurez-vous que Kafka a été correctement installé et qu'il fonctionne. Selon vos besoins et votre environnement, configurez les paramètres Kafka, tels que l'adresse du courtier, le port, etc.

2. Créer un sujet : La création d'un sujet dans Kafka peut être effectuée de différentes manières, notamment par l'interface de ligne de commande, les outils de gestion Kafka ou l'API de programmation. Voici les étapes pour créer un sujet à l'aide de l'interface de ligne de commande :

  • Ouvrez un terminal ou une invite de commande et accédez au répertoire d'installation de Kafka ou au répertoire bin configuré.

  • Exécutez la commande suivante pour créer le sujet (remplacez par le nom de votre sujet, par le nombre de partitions souhaité, par le facteur de réplication souhaité) :

  • bash`./b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ic `

  • This La commande utilise ZooKeeper comme stockage de métadonnées pour créer des sujets. Si vous utilisez une nouvelle version de Kafka, vous pouvez utiliser différentes commandes ou paramètres de configuration. Veuillez consulter la documentation officielle ou les informations d'aide en fonction de votre version de Kafka.

3. Vérifiez la création du sujet : Après une création réussie, vous pouvez utiliser la commande suivante pour vérifier si le sujet a été créé avec succès :

./bin/kafka-topics.sh --list --zookeeper localhost:2181
Copier après la connexion

Cette commande listera tous les sujets créés sur l'instance ZooKeeper spécifiée. Vous devriez pouvoir voir le nom du thème que vous venez de créer dans la liste.

4. Configurer les paramètres du sujet : Lors de la création d'un sujet, vous pouvez également le configurer via d'autres paramètres

, tels que la définition de la taille maximale de chaque partition, du facteur de réplication, de la compression, etc. Ces paramètres peuvent être ajustés selon vos besoins. Pour plus de détails, consultez la section « Création d'un sujet » dans la documentation officielle de Kafka.

5. Pensez à utiliser Kafka Manager ou Confluent Control Center : Si vous souhaitez gérer plus facilement les sujets Kafka et d'autres opérations (telles que l'affichage des indicateurs de performance, la surveillance, etc.), vous pouvez envisager d'utiliser des outils tels que Kafka Manager ou Centre de contrôle Confluent. Ces outils fournissent une interface visuelle qui vous permet de gérer facilement les clusters et sujets Kafka.

6. Notes :

* Avant de créer un sujet, assurez-vous que le cluster Kafka a été démarré et fonctionne normalement.

* Assurez-vous d'avoir les autorisations suffisantes pour créer le sujet. Généralement, des droits d'administrateur sont requis pour effectuer cette opération.

* Le choix du facteur de partition et de réplication affectera les performances et la tolérance aux pannes de Kafka. Choisissez la valeur appropriée en fonction des besoins réels et de l'environnement.

* Si vous utilisez un service Kafka dans un environnement cloud (comme AWS MSK, Google Cloud Pub/Sub, etc.), les méthodes et commandes de création de sujets peuvent être différentes. Veuillez vous référer à la documentation du service correspondant pour plus de détails.

Veuillez noter que la méthode générale fournie ici est basée sur Apache Kafka. Votre implémentation et votre environnement spécifiques peuvent varier, il est donc recommandé de consulter la documentation officielle de la version de Kafka que vous utilisez pour obtenir des informations précises et à jour.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Étiquettes associées:
source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al